Wickford Point is the somewhat dilapidated but stately home of the Boston Brahmin Brill family. The story, such as it is, is told by Jim a distant relative who grew up at Wickford Point after his parents died. It is based on, I am supposing, Marquand’s life and you Wickford Point book still find the estate where he grew up on the Merrimack River near /5(7).
Another Panel in his New England portraits, to go along side of THE LATE GEORGE APLEY. This is, perhaps, not so original a book; there is less sense of actuality, more sense of plot.
The emphasis lies this time, not on an individual primarily, but on a place which has an irresistible hold over all the members of a family, and brings them back and back again.
The family could happen nowhere but. "Jim is the only member of the extended Brill family at Wickford Point ever to have any money in his pocket. The rest of the Brills siphon gas from his car and overdraw their accounts with the cheerful abandon of those who have always been taken care of.
